If you moved from United Kingdom to Guinea-Bissau, and you’d need to navigate life in Portuguese and Upper Guinea Creole. You’ll also switch from driving on the left to the right. Expect a noticeable climate shift — Bissau averages 90°F vs 60°F in London, making it significantly warmer.

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between United Kingdom and Guinea-Bissau. To live, work, or study long-term in Guinea-Bissau,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Guinea-Bissau's immigration authority.

United Kingdom passport

United Kingdom passport holder visiting Guinea-Bissau

Visa on Arrival
United Kingdom passport holders can obtain a visa on arrival in Guinea-Bissau.
Guinea-Bissau passport

Guinea-Bissau passport holder visiting United Kingdom

Visa Online (e-Visa)
Guinea-Bissau passport holders need to apply for an e-Visa before travelling to United Kingdom.

What's the weather like in Guinea-Bissau compared to United Kingdom?

The average high temperature in Bissau is 90°F, compared to 60°F in London. Bissau receives around 69.1 in of rainfall per year, while London gets 22.0 in.

What language do they speak in Guinea-Bissau?

The official languages in Guinea-Bissau are Portuguese and Upper Guinea Creole. In United Kingdom, the official language is English.
